What is subluxation of a bone?

A dislocation occurs when the bones in a joint become separated or knocked out of their usual positions. Any joint in the body can become dislocated. If the joint is partially dislocated, it is called a subluxation.

What does it mean to Sublux a joint?

A subluxation is basically defined as “a partial dislocation”. It can be no less painful than a full dislocation, but the two bones that form the joint are still partially in contact with each other.

What is subluxation another term for?

Subluxation: Partial dislocation of a joint. A complete dislocation is a luxation.

What does subluxation mean medical?

In medicine, a subluxation is an incomplete or partial dislocation of a joint or organ.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), a subluxation is a “significant structural displacement” and is therefore always visible on static imaging studies, such as X-rays. What is medial subluxation?

In the wrist, a Medial Subluxation most commonly refers to a partial dislocation of the distal radioulnar joint. This is a joint at the wrist responsible for connecting both the ulna (little-finger-side forearm bone) and the radius (thumb-side forearm bone) to the rest of the wrist, hence the name radioulnar.

What is subluxation of toe?

Subluxed toe. A partial loss of contact between two joint surfaces, due to the capsule and ligaments holding the joint together being compromised, resulting in the bones making up the joint to be no longer aligned.

What is subluxation spine?

Subluxation Definition. “Subluxation” is a term used by some chiropractors to describe a spinal vertebra that is out of position in comparison to the other vertebrae, possibly resulting in functional loss and determining where the chiropractor should manipulate the spine.
